The Incredible Skin-Benefiting Power of Chamomile: A Natural Remedy for Radiant Skin
Chamomile is a daisy-like flower that has been used for centuries for its medicinal properties. It is most commonly known for its calming and relaxing effects, but it also has a number of benefits for the skin.
Chamomile contains antioxidants that help to protect the skin from damage caused by free radicals. Free radicals are unstable molecules that can damage cells and lead to premature aging. Chamomile also has anti-inflammatory properties that can help to reduce redness and swelling. Additionally, chamomile is a natural moisturizer that can help to keep the skin hydrated and soft.
Chamomile can be used in a variety of ways to benefit the skin. It can be added to baths, used as a compress, or applied directly to the skin. Chamomile is also available in a variety of products, such as soaps, lotions, and creams.
1. Anti-inflammatory
The anti-inflammatory properties of chamomile make it an effective remedy for various skin conditions characterized by redness, irritation, and inflammation. Its soothing effects help calm and reduce these symptoms, promoting skin health and comfort.
Inflammation is a natural response to injury or irritation. However, chronic inflammation can damage the skin and lead to conditions such as eczema, psoriasis, and rosacea. Chamomile’s anti-inflammatory properties help to reduce inflammation, thereby alleviating the associated symptoms and promoting skin healing.
For instance, chamomile extract has been shown to soothe and reduce redness in individuals with eczema. Its anti-inflammatory effects help calm irritated skin, alleviate itching, and restore skin’s natural balance. Additionally, chamomile’s moisturizing properties help hydrate and protect the skin, further contributing to its soothing and healing benefits.
The anti-inflammatory properties of chamomile make it a valuable ingredient in skincare products designed for sensitive and irritated skin. It is often found in lotions, creams, and serums formulated to soothe and calm inflamed skin conditions.
2. Antioxidant
The antioxidant properties of chamomile are of great significance in protecting the skin against free radical damage, which is a major contributing factor to premature skin aging. Free radicals are unstable molecules produced by the body’s metabolism and environmental factors like UV radiation and pollution. They can damage skin cells, leading to wrinkles, fine lines, and age spots.
Chamomile contains potent antioxidants, such as flavonoids and terpenoids, which help neutralize free radicals and prevent them from damaging the skin. Studies have shown that chamomile extract can protect the skin from UV-induced damage, reducing the formation of wrinkles and age spots. Additionally, chamomile’s anti-inflammatory properties help soothe and calm the skin, further protecting it from damage.
Incorporating chamomile into your skincare routine can help protect your skin from premature aging and preserve its youthful appearance. Chamomile is available in various forms, including teas, extracts, and topical products like lotions and creams. Regular use of chamomile-infused skincare products can help combat the effects of free radical damage, promote skin health, and maintain a youthful glow.

4. Antibacterial
The antibacterial properties of chamomile make it an effective natural remedy for acne-prone skin. Acne is a common skin condition caused by the overproduction of sebum, which can clog pores and lead to the formation of pimples and blackheads. Certain bacteria, such as Propionibacterium acnes (P. acnes), thrive in these clogged pores and contribute to the development of acne lesions.
Chamomile extract has been shown to possess antibacterial activity against P. acnes, helping to reduce the bacteria population on the skin. By combating these acne-causing bacteria, chamomile helps prevent the formation of new acne lesions and promotes clearer, healthier skin.
Incorporating chamomile into your skincare routine can be beneficial for managing acne. Chamomile-infused products, such as cleansers, toners, and masks, can help cleanse the skin, remove excess oil, and reduce the presence of acne-causing bacteria. Regular use of these products can help improve the skin’s clarity and reduce the severity of acne breakouts.
Overall, the antibacterial properties of chamomile make it a valuable component of skincare regimens for acne-prone skin. Its ability to combat acne-causing bacteria helps promote clearer, healthier skin, reducing the appearance of pimples and blackheads.

FAQs on Benefits of Chamomile for Skin
This section addresses common questions and misconceptions regarding the benefits of chamomile for skin, providing clear and concise answers based on scientific evidence and expert opinions.
Question 1: Is chamomile safe for all skin types?
Chamomile is generally considered safe for most skin types, including sensitive skin. However, as with any skincare product, it is always advisable to perform a patch test on a small area of skin before applying it to larger areas.
Question 2: Can chamomile help reduce the appearance of wrinkles?
Chamomile contains antioxidants that help protect the skin from free radical damage, which can contribute to the formation of wrinkles. While chamomile may not directly reduce the appearance of existing wrinkles, it can help prevent future wrinkle formation by protecting the skin from environmental stressors.
Question 3: Is chamomile effective in treating acne?
Chamomile has antibacterial properties that may help reduce acne-causing bacteria on the skin. However, it is important to note that chamomile alone may not be sufficient to treat severe acne. It is generally recommended to consult a dermatologist for appropriate acne treatment options.
Question 4: Can chamomile help soothe skin irritation caused by eczema or psoriasis?
Chamomile’s anti-inflammatory properties may help soothe skin irritation and reduce redness associated with eczema and psoriasis. However, it is important to use chamomile in conjunction with other prescribed treatments and consult a healthcare professional for proper management of these skin conditions.
Question 5: How can I incorporate chamomile into my skincare routine?
Chamomile can be incorporated into your skincare routine in several ways. You can use chamomile-infused products such as cleansers, toners, and moisturizers. You can also make your own chamomile tea and use it as a skin rinse or compress.
Question 6: Are there any side effects of using chamomile on the skin?
Chamomile is generally safe for topical use, but some people may experience allergic reactions. If you experience any irritation or discomfort after using chamomile, discontinue use and consult a healthcare professional.
